Introduction to Agricultural Engineering Management

  • Overview of agricultural engineering and its importance.
  • Key management principles in agricultural engineering.
  • Roles and responsibilities of an agricultural engineer.
  • Strategic planning and decision-making in agricultural operations.

Project Management in Agricultural Engineering

  • Stages of agricultural engineering projects: planning, design, implementation, and evaluation.
  • Budgeting and cost control in agricultural engineering projects.
  • Risk management and mitigation strategies.
  • Tools and techniques for project monitoring and evaluation.

Technology and Innovation in Agricultural Engineering

  • Role of technology in improving agricultural productivity.
  • Advances in machinery, irrigation systems, and automation.
  • Sustainable agricultural practices and innovations.
  • Case studies of successful technological integration in agriculture.

Resource Management and Sustainability in Agricultural Engineering

  • Efficient management of land, water, and labor resources.
  • Sustainable practices in agricultural engineering.
  • Energy management in agricultural operations.
  • Legal and environmental considerations in agricultural engineering.
